The white wine clees resérve Hammelburger Traustlestal Weißer Burgunder trocken, vintage 2016 from the winery Weingut Baldauf has been rated in 2020 by Ulrich Sautter with 90 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Weißburgunder from the region Franconia in Germany.
Tasting Notes
Initially open fruit, red peach and apricot puree, also balsamic-lime savoury aromas. On the palate, medium-bodied in extract and "cool" in impression, the late harvest fruit of the bouquet suggests a little more fullness, but the fine, nervous and delicately mineral-toned structure has its own qualities and shows a drinking flow supported by the fine ripe aromas.
